How Indianapolis IN Obituaries Actually Works

So, how do online obituaries work, exactly? Essentially, these platforms allow users to create and share digital tributes, complete with photos, stories, and other personal details. Obituaries can be created by family members, friends, or even funeral homes, and are often used to share news of a loved one's passing with a wider audience.

Key Insights

Using online obituaries is surprisingly straightforward. Users can create an account, select a template, and begin adding content and photos. Many platforms also offer tools for sharing and connecting with others, making it easy to build a community around a loved one's memory.

Common Questions People Have About Indianapolis IN Obituaries

  • **What's the purpose of online obituaries?**Online obituaries serve several purposes, including providing a space for loved ones to share news of a passing, creating a digital legacy, and connecting with others who may be grieving.

  • **Are online obituaries secure and respectful?**Most online obituary platforms take care to ensure that user data and content is handled with respect and dignity. When creating an obituary, users can choose to share as much or as little information as they like.

  • **Can I use online obituaries if I'm not tech-savvy?**Absolutely! Many online obituary platforms are designed to be user-friendly, even for those who may not be tech-savvy. Help sections and customer support are often available to guide users through the process.

Opportunities and Considerations

While online obituaries offer many benefits, there are also some important considerations to keep in mind. For one, online memorials can be vulnerable to hacking or other forms of digital exploitation. It's essential to choose a reputable platform and take steps to protect user data.

Additionally, online obituaries may not be suitable for all families or circumstances. Some may prefer traditional funeral services or in-person memorials, and that's perfectly okay.
